Security forces kill 24 terrorists in 3-day clearance operation in Machh

F.P. Report

ISLAMABAD: The security forces have completed sanitization and clearance operations in Machh three days after the militant attack, killing 24 terrorists in total.

According to an ISPR statement released in Rawalpindi on Friday, during these three days 24 terrorists in total were eliminated in different actions.

“On the night between 29 and 30 January 2024, terrorists attacked Machh and Kolpur Complexes in Balochistan. Law enforcement agencies deputed on security offered stiff resistance and forced the attackers to repulse. These terrorists were then hunted down in the ensuing sanitization and clearance operations which have now been concluded after clearing and securing the area,” the ISPR said.

During the firefights and sanitization/clearance operations, in last three days, 24 terrorists had been sent to hell, the ISPR said, adding terrorists Shehzad Baloch, Attaullah, Salah Uddin, Abdul Wadood and Zeeshan were key figures among the dead. Identification process of remaining terrorists was in process.

However, during intense exchange of fire, four brave members of law enforcement agencies, having fought gallantly, embraced Shahadat along with two innocent civilians.
